    Facebook is looking for experts in economics and computation (EconCS) to join the Core Data Science team. The team works on a variety of practical research problems in domains such as ads, integrity, social impact, and more. The most qualified applicants will have a passion for bringing their expertise in EconCS into practice, working closely with both researchers in other fields as well as product teams to shape the way people and businesses interact with the platform.

    Core Data Science is a research and development team, working to improve Facebook’s products, infrastructure, and processes. We generate real-world impact through a combination of scientific rigour and methodological innovation. We are an interdisciplinary team, with expertise in computer science, statistics, machine learning, economics, political science, operations research, and computational social science, among other fields. This diversity of perspectives enriches our research and expands the scope and scale of projects we can address.

    Research Scientist, Core Data Science Responsibilities

    • Design and implement scalable and scientifically sound solutions to mechanism design and optimization problems using either existing or novel methods on top of Facebook's data infrastructure.

    • Work towards long-term ambitious research goals, while identifying intermediate milestones.

    • Apply excellent communication skills to develop cross-functional partnerships throughout the company.

    • Be able to work both independently and collaboratively with other scientists, engineers, designers, UX researchers, and product managers to accomplish complex tasks that deliver demonstrable value to Facebook's community of over 2 billion users.

    • Think creatively, proactively, and futuristically to identify new opportunities within Facebook's long term roadmap for data-scientific contributions.

    Minimum Qualifications

    • Ph.D. degree in computer science, economics, computational social science, statistics, and related fields or MS degree with relevant experience.

    • Expertise in algorithmic game theory, market design, optimization, and/or machine learning.

    • Experience with data analysis using tools such as R or Python, with packages such as NumPy, SciPy, pandas, scikit-learn, tidyverse (dplyr, ggplot2, etc.).

    • Ability to initiate and drive research projects to completion with minimal guidance.

    • The ability to communicate scientific work in a clear and effective manner.

    Preferred Qualifications

    • Publications in relevant technical fields (e.g., EC, WINE, NeurIPS, AAAI, STOC, FOCS, WWW).

    • Experience in lower level programming languages such as C++.

    • Experience in scalable dataset assembly / data wrangling, such as Presto, Hive or Spark.
